A digital watermark
RG Van Schyndel, AZ Tirkel… - Proceedings of 1st …, 1994 - ieeexplore.ieee.org
The paper discusses the feasibility of coding an" undetectable" digital water mark on a
standard 512/spl times/512 intensity image with an 8 bit gray scale. The watermark is …
standard 512/spl times/512 intensity image with an 8 bit gray scale. The watermark is …
Adding trace matching with free variables to AspectJ
C Allan, P Avgustinov, AS Christensen… - ACM SIGPLAN …, 2005 - dl.acm.org
An aspect observes the execution of a base program; when certain actions occur, the aspect
runs some extra code of its own. In the AspectJ language, the observations that an aspect …
runs some extra code of its own. In the AspectJ language, the observations that an aspect …
JAsCo: an aspect-oriented approach tailored for component based software development
D Suvée, W Vanderperren, V Jonckers - Proceedings of the 2nd …, 2003 - dl.acm.org
In this paper we introduce a novel aspect oriented implementation language, called JAsCo.
JAsCo is tailored for component based development and the Java Beans component model …
JAsCo is tailored for component based development and the Java Beans component model …
Composition, reuse and interaction analysis of stateful aspects
Aspect-Oriented Programming promises separation of concerns at the implementation level.
However, aspects are not always orrthogonal and aspect interaction is a fundamental …
However, aspects are not always orrthogonal and aspect interaction is a fundamental …
Partial behavioral reflection: Spatial and temporal selection of reification
Behavioral reflection is a powerful approach for adapting the behavior of running
applications. In this paper we present and motivate partial behavioral reflection, an …
applications. In this paper we present and motivate partial behavioral reflection, an …
Expressive pointcuts for increased modularity
In aspect-oriented programming, pointcuts are used to describe crosscutting structure.
Pointcuts that abstract over irrelevant implementation details are clearly desired to better …
Pointcuts that abstract over irrelevant implementation details are clearly desired to better …
MATA: A unified approach for composing UML aspect models based on graph transformation
This paper describes MATA (Modeling Aspects Using a Transformation Approach), a UML
aspect-oriented modeling (AOM) technique that uses graph transformations to specify and …
aspect-oriented modeling (AOM) technique that uses graph transformations to specify and …
An aspect-oriented approach for developing self-adaptive fractal components
PC David, T Ledoux - International Conference on Software Composition, 2006 - Springer
Nowadays, application developers have to deal with increasingly variable execution
contexts, requiring the creation of applications able to adapt themselves autonomously to …
contexts, requiring the creation of applications able to adapt themselves autonomously to …
Explicitly distributed AOP using AWED
LDB Navarro, M Südholt, W Vanderperren… - Proceedings of the 5th …, 2006 - dl.acm.org
Distribution-related concerns, such as data replication, often crosscut the business code of a
distributed application. Currently such crosscutting concerns are frequently realized on top …
distributed application. Currently such crosscutting concerns are frequently realized on top …